# CI Note: Health Checks Behind Northgate LB

The Northgate load balancer marks Pellworth API nodes unhealthy during deploys because the health endpoint returns 503 while caches warm. CI's smoke stage then flaps. Workaround: the warmup probe must hit /ready, not /health, and wait for two consecutive passes. Don't raise the timeout; it masks real failures. The last green run's trace token is noted below.

build token for fajof-yahof: htk4_869f

Welcome to on-call for Tindergrove Calendar! Most pages come from the sync-conflict resolver choking on double-booked events. Usually a restart clears it; if not, check the merge queue depth in the ops panel. To run the resolver locally you'll need the sync service's env file, and its provider access secret sits on the next line.

vault entry, yahif-yajep: COURIER_KEY29=b802bdf8034096b65a51c6ba5abe2

## Authentication

Undo/redo in Sketchloom is handled server-side. Each edit to a diagram pushes an operation onto the history stack via the Chronicle service. Undo pops and inverts; redo replays. History calls require auth — anonymous sessions get a local-only stack that is discarded on reload. Max depth is 200 ops per diagram. All Chronicle requests must carry a service token with `history:write` scope. For the sync demo environment, use the key that follows.

app token of yajeg-kawef = kto11_7En3XSX8xQw

Subject: Cache invalidation ownership change

Welcome aboard. Quick note: ownership of cache invalidation for the Verdant catalog service has moved off the platform squad. This covers the TTL rules, the purge-on-update hooks, and the stale-price alarm. Do not ship changes to the invalidation layer without sign-off. All related tickets route to the new owner effective Monday. Direct any catalog staleness reports to the person named below.

approver of bagug-bagag = Holael Pramir

Subject: First-aid room, Level 2 — night access

Night shift: the first-aid room beside the Larkspur Wing lifts is now locked overnight after supplies went missing. Defibrillator and kits remain inside. In an emergency, do not wait for the duty manager — enter directly and log the incident afterwards. To open the door, use the code below.

door code, yagap-bahof: bdg-O-05